Building permits are an important aspect of the development and renovation course of, performing as a legal requirement that ensures compliance with local codes and laws. When an individual or a enterprise plans to undertake any construction, they have to seek approval from the local authorities. This process not solely protects public safety but additionally helps maintain the structural integrity of buildings in the surrounding community.
The utility for a building permit requires detailed plans that outline the proposed work. These plans embody architectural designs, structural issues, and sometimes environmental impacts. When stuffed out appropriately, the permit application helps native officials perceive both the scope of the project and its implications for the neighborhood.
Upon submission, related authorities will review the appliance to make sure it aligns with zoning laws, safety requirements, and other rules - Home Handyman & Office Repair specialists Winnetka, CA. This evaluation process usually consists of checking for adherence to building codes that dictate the minimum requirements for construction practices. Local codes make sure that structures are safe and liveable, preventing potential hazards corresponding to hearth risk or structural weak spot

Once the applying is accredited, a building permit is issued. This doc grants permission to begin construction whereas also outlining what can and can't be carried out. It serves as a tenet for both the contractors concerned and the inspectors who will later verify that the project adheres to the permitted plans.
During construction, ongoing inspections shall be required to observe compliance with the permit circumstances. These inspections can cowl various elements, including plumbing methods, electrical installations, and structural integrity. Ensuring adherence to the permit all through the construction course of minimizes the risk of future problems, each for the builder and the occupants.

Failing to obtain or comply with a building permit can lead to serious consequences, including fines, cessation of work, or even legal actions. Local governments have the authority to implement building codes rigorously, which might embody requiring the demolition of a construction that was constructed without correct permits. This unpredictability makes it essential for anyone considering construction to prioritize obtaining their permits.
The prices related to building permits can vary widely, depending on the project's size, kind, and placement. Fees are sometimes tiered primarily based on particular standards, making it crucial for homeowners and contractors to understand the breakdown. Additionally, some localities may provide sources or payment waivers to encourage certain types of development, such as affordable housing initiatives.
In many circumstances, building permits also can have an impact on the overall timeline of a project. For those planning to construct or renovate, understanding the allowing process is vital. Delays in permit approval can push back begin dates, which, in turn, can have an effect on everything from scheduling contractors to budgeting for prices.
Moreover, participating with the group is often an integral part of the permit course of. Public hearings might occur, throughout which neighbors can categorical their considerations or support for a project. This added layer of enter helps to maintain the character of existing neighborhoods and fosters goodwill amongst future neighbors.

Building permits aren't solely for new construction but in addition cover renovations, repairs, and even certain alterations to present constructions. Whether it's adding a deck, ending a basement, or altering the exterior facade, obtaining the best permits ensures that these adjustments comply with present legal guidelines and requirements.
In many regions, there are various varieties of permits based on various standards. These can embrace basic building permits, electrical permits, plumbing permits, and more, each with its own software necessities and processes. What is a building permit and why do I want one?
A building permit is an official approval issued by your local authorities that allows you to proceed with construction or renovation tasks. It ensures that your project adheres to local zoning laws, building codes, and safety rules. Obtaining a permit is crucial to avoid authorized issues and potential fines.

How long does it take to get a building permit?
The timeframe for obtaining a building permit can differ extensively based mostly on your location, the complexity of the project, and the volume of applications the building department is handling. Generally, it could possibly take anywhere from a couple of days to several weeks. Planning forward may help keep away from any pointless delays.

What occurs in the course of the building permit evaluation process?
During the building permit evaluation course of, your submitted plans and software shall be evaluated by local officials to ensure compliance with building codes, zoning laws, and safety standards. They might request modifications or further info earlier than deciding whether to approve or deny the permit.

Are there fees related to acquiring a building permit?
Yes, most jurisdictions cost a payment for processing building permit applications. The amount can rely upon the kind of project, its measurement, and local rules. It's advisable to inquire in regards to the complete costs involved when submitting your utility to keep away from surprises.
What are the results of not having a building permit?
Failure to obtain a building permit can lead to fines, forced removal of unpermitted work, or authorized motion. Additionally, not having a permit can complicate future property transactions and affect insurance coverage protection, as unpermitted work may not meet safety requirements.

Can I work with no building permit on minor repairs?
It is dependent upon your local regulations. Some jurisdictions enable minor repairs and maintenance tasks to be carried out without a permit. However, it’s crucial to confirm together with your local building authority to make sure compliance and avoid potential issues.

What should I do if my building permit is denied?
If your building permit is denied, you'll receive a notice outlining the explanations for the denial. You can correct the problems recognized, revise your plans accordingly, and reapply. Alternatively, you may also appeal the choice, depending on native regulations.
